Output ec30f28e7c512d7cb74d4d5f78aca2e4537da445a9ba43705e92199648b0b7a4:46

value
10371662
script pubkey
OP_0 OP_PUSHBYTES_20 d2e77056b77f77c94b11cf5c3bae71b9aecaf19c
address
bc1q6tnhq44h0amujjc3eawrhtn3hxhv4uvu3cp4n5
transaction
ec30f28e7c512d7cb74d4d5f78aca2e4537da445a9ba43705e92199648b0b7a4